Considering a move from Connecticut to Belarus? Here's how the two compare on cost, climate, safety, and more.

If you moved from Connecticut to Belarus, you would find that Belarus is 62.3% cheaper than Connecticut. A $75,000 salary in Connecticut would need to be roughly BYN77,313 in Belarus to maintain the same lifestyle, and you’d need to navigate life in Belarusian and Russian. Expect a noticeable climate shift — Minsk averages 50°F vs 61°F in Bridgeport, making it significantly cooler.

Visitor Visa Requirements

Short-stay tourist visa rules between United States and Belarus. To live, work, or study long-term in Belarus, you'll need a separate residence or work visa — check Belarus's immigration authority.

United States passport

United States passport holder visiting Belarus

Visa Online (e-Visa)
United States passport holders need to apply for an e-Visa before travelling to Belarus.
Belarus passport

Belarus passport holder visiting United States

Visa Required
Belarus passport holders need a visa to enter United States.

What's the weather like in Belarus compared to Connecticut?

The average high temperature in Minsk is 50°F, compared to 61°F in Bridgeport. Minsk receives around 26.7 in of rainfall per year, while Bridgeport gets 47.7 in.

What language do they speak in Belarus?

The official languages in Belarus are Belarusian and Russian. In Connecticut, the official language is English.
